Abstract
We propose a novel scheme to reduce the sensitivity to pump power variation in optical fiber anemometers that used fiber Bragg grating (FBG) inscribed in light absorption optical fibers. By modulating the output power of the pump laser and by measuring the time constant of the wavelength change of the FBG sensor, we theoretically and experimentally demonstrated that significant reduction of the sensitivity of flow measurement to pump power can be achieved.
